AC Milan head coach Stefano Pioli tests positive for COVID-19

Stefano Pioli, head coach of Serie A club AC Milan, has tested positive for novel coronavirus, the club has informed. Pioli is asymptomatic and currently at home quarantine.

"AC Milan announces that Stefano Pioli has tested positive following a quick test carried out this morning. The health authorities have been informed, and the coach, who is currently showing no symptoms, has gone into quarantine at home," AC Milan said in a statement.

"All other tests carried out by the squad and staff came back negative. As a result, today's training session has been cancelled. Training ahead of the match with Napoli will resume on Monday, subject to the checks set out in the federal protocol," it added. Earlier, Zlatan Ibrahimovic, Daniel Maldini, Matteo Gabbia and Leo Duarte of AC Milan had also been diagnosed with Covid-19.
